Choosing a smartwatch for multiple sports begins with understanding your activity mix and training goals. Look for devices that offer a broad sport catalog, from cardio-centric workouts like running and cycling to strength sessions, swimming, and hiking. A reliable unit should automatically detect transitions, provide real-time metrics, and store historical performance so you can track progress over weeks and months. Consider whether the watch supports both indoor and outdoor modes, weather resilience, and quick-switch functionality between activities. Battery life matters, especially during long sessions or triathlons, so compare endurance in GPS-intensive modes and in smartwatch defaults. Finally, verify that the display remains legible in bright sun or dim gym lighting.
Beyond core sport support, a smartwatch earns its keep with customizable training plans that adapt to your schedule and fitness level. Seek platforms that let you create or import plans, assign workouts by day, and adjust intensity based on recent performance or rest days. A robust system should offer progressive overload, built-in recovery cues, and reminders to stay hydrated or warm up adequately. Compatibility with third-party coaching apps and cloud synchronization helps preserve your plan across devices. It’s useful when the watch suggests micro-adjustments if you miss a session or if fatigue indicators trend downward. Finally, verify how easy it is to navigate training menus during a workout without sacrificing data visibility or safety.

When assessing sport coverage, evaluate the breadth of activities offered by the watch and how deeply they measure essential metrics. Running is common, but effective coaching also requires cadence, pace, heart rate zones, and VO2 max trends. For swimming, look for waterproofing to at least 50 meters and stroke recognition that differentiates freestyle, breaststroke, and backstroke. Strength and mobility sessions benefit from activity-specific metrics like range of motion estimates and timers for work-to-rest ratios. Training plans become valuable when they translate data into actionable steps, such as weekly volume targets, rest days, and finish-line goals. A well-integrated ecosystem connects with mobile apps, health data, and your preferred cloud account for seamless access.

In practice, you’ll want a training-plans feature that isn’t gimmicky but actually guides your progress. Start with a flexible calendar that shows planned workouts at a glance and updates after each session. The ability to adjust workouts on the fly—moving a hard run to a lighter day or replacing a skipped session with an alternative cross-training option—saves time and reduces frustration. Look for adaptive plans that respond to recent performance, sleep quality, and stress levels. The best watches provide clear visual cues, such as color-coded intensity, progress bars, and gentle reminders to stay consistent. Finally, ensure the interface remains intuitive during workouts so you can monitor heart rate, pace, or distance without pausing frequently.

Sensor accuracy underpins trust in any smartwatch. Optical heart-rate sensors work well at rest and during steady effort but can drift during high-intensity bursts or uneven arm movement. Multiband GPS improves route precision, which is crucial for trail runners or cyclists on winding courses. Elevation measurements should align with barometric data for climbs and descents. Waterproofing safeguards the device during swims, but the sensor layout also matters for durability in sweaty workouts and after rain. Comfort is equally important; choose a lightweight model with a breathable strap and multiple size options to prevent chafing during extended sessions. A longer warranty and reliable software updates protect your investment over time.

Beyond hardware, the software ecosystem drives real value. A polished companion app should present a clean dashboard that highlights current plan status, workout history, and goal progress without overwhelming you with data. Synchronization with health services and other devices reduces friction in your daily routine. App stability matters: frequent crashes or sluggish syncing undermine motivation. User-generated content, such as community challenges or coaching templates, can add motivation, provided moderation keeps data accurate. Battery-life optimizations and offline map access for unfamiliar routes are practical benefits for runners and cyclists who train outside. Finally, assess customer support options and accessibility of troubleshooting resources since software quirks can pop up over time.

Budgeting for a smartwatch means weighing upfront cost against ongoing value. Entry-level options typically cover essential watches that track workouts, estimate calories, and provide basic GPS. Mid-range devices usually add more precise GPS, better sensors, longer battery life, and a larger, brighter display. Premium models often include advanced metrics like skin temperature, respiration monitoring, on-device coaching, and highly customizable training plans. Consider the total cost of ownership: do you need a premium strap, replacement bands, or extra charging cables? How often will you upgrade for new sensors or features? A device with a strong software update policy and access to a broad library of training templates is likely to stay relevant longer, which increases long-term value.
The right watch for you balances hardware capabilities with your preferred training style. If you run and cycle intensely, prioritize GPS reliability and low-latency heart-rate readings. Swimmers should favor precise water ingress protection and stroke detection that aligns with your swimming program. For gym-based training or cross-training, look for robust activity recognition and the ability to create workouts that combine intervals, strength sets, and mobility work. Remember that customization shines when you can tailor measurements to your goals, such as setting target pace ranges, customizing field names, or exporting your data for a coach. Choose a platform that encourages habit formation through reminders, streaks, and reward systems that feel motivating rather than punitive.

Before buying, simulate a typical week of activity to see how the watch performs in real settings. Start with a structured run where pace, distance, and HR zones are monitored and compare readings with a trusted external device if possible. Add a cycling session to assess GPS drift on turns and elevations, followed by a strength workout to observe motion tracking and rest timers. Swimming laps should test waterproofing, stroke detection, and wall-turn accuracy. Use the training plan feature to schedule three workouts across the week and observe how the watch handles reminders, rest day suggestions, and plan adjustments. Observing battery behavior during these tests helps determine if you’ll need a midweek recharge.
After hands-on evaluation, review data management and app compatibility. Ensure workouts export to common formats or coach portals you already use, so your training won’t be stranded inside the device’s ecosystem. Check whether the watch supports offline maps for long runs in remote areas and if route memory can store past favorite routes. Confirm that software updates remain accessible and non-disruptive, particularly around the time you rely on the watch most. A good smartwatch should feel like a reliable training partner, not a fragile gadget. Finally, read user feedback about long-term reliability, battery longevity, and the quality of on-device coaching features.
At the end of the search, you want a device that aligns with your sports mix, training philosophy, and daily life. Start with sport coverage, ensuring your core activities are supported with meaningful metrics. Then confirm the richness and adaptability of customizable training plans, including automatic adjustments based on progress and recovery signals. Next, assess hardware comfort and longevity: weight, strap materials, screen visibility, and water resistance. The software layer should feel intuitive, with a straightforward setup, clear workout views, and reliable cloud sync. Finally, factor in your budget and expected upgrade cycle. A smartwatch that offers ongoing updates, a robust support network, and a track record of reliability will be valuable for years to come.
When you settle on a model, give yourself a onboarding period to tailor settings, calibrate sensors, and build your first week’s plan. Start by configuring metric priorities: pace, HR zones, cadence, or power, depending on your sport focus. Customize notifications to minimize distraction during workouts while maintaining essential alerts such as rest reminders and hydration nudges. Create a baseline training plan and gradually introduce more complex sessions as you grow comfortable. Keep an eye on battery life under typical use and adjust screen brightness or GPS settings to optimize endurance. Finally, keep a backup plan for activities you’re likely to miss, so the plan remains flexible rather than rigid, preserving motivation and safety.
